On Thu, Jul 02, 2009 at 09:53:05AM +0200, Ingo Molnar wrote:
> > That shouldn't be a problem if we were about to panic(). For a
> > more sophisticated attempt of recovery -- yes, that would have to
> > be addressed.
>
> We are only panic-ing if the sysctl is set. The diagnostics would be
> useful anyway. The proper approach would be to defer it a bit in the
> non-panic case an read it out from some friendlier context - such as
> the EDAC core.
Quickly skimming through code shows some functionality is there:
drivers/edac/edac_pci{,_sysfs}.c but doesn't seem to be NMI safe. CCing
some more people.
